Voice and tone
Voice — Calm expert neighbor: competent, plainspoken, never sneering at beginners.
Tone — Warm by default; more direct in error messages and security notes.
Principles
- Lead with the user outcome, then the mechanism.
- Prefer short sentences; one idea per line in UI copy.
- Avoid hype adjectives (“revolutionary,” “game-changing”) unless tied to measurable proof.
Do / don’t
| Do | Don’t |
|---|---|
| “Your notes stay in a folder you control.” | “We leverage best-in-class synergies.” |
| “If sync fails, check your API token.” | “Oops! Something went wrong.” (without next step) |
| “Try this on a copy of your vault first.” | “Simply run the migration.” |
Words we like
- vault, index, export, plain Markdown
Words to use carefully
- AI — name the task (“summarize,” “extract tasks”) not the mystique.
- Local-first — define once per article for new readers.
